Back to CnC, I've reached about level 12. So far only played offensive. I get the feeling this game is going to end up one of two ways due to the fact that so far, if you're a higher level you're probably gonna win.
It's either gonna be lilke WoW - where the real game is the end game. Once you've hit max level and you're playing with other max levels, it becomes a fair fighting ground once again. However, this leads to the other possible outcome.
The other way I See it unfolding is that the game will stalemate. I've had a few fights so far where I've been raped, come back, raped them, and repeat. The problem lies in the lack of bases again, there aren't any structures I can take out to weaken my enemy and there are no structures I need to defend for my life.
This could all just be because of the domination game mode, though...
I mean, if there is a game mode where you can only produce while you have your MCV intact, and you and your 4 teams mates band together to FORM a base, then you'd have more of a CnC experience but with all of you controlling what one of you would have controlled in prior games.
The game is entertaining enough to keep me playing, but I think that's just my addiction to thinking the word "Ding" in my head every time I level!

Some excerpts:  |  |  |  | Quote: It must have looked like a great idea on paper. "The kids love Modern Warfare! Let's do that, but in an RTS! We can't fail." But they have failed. It's depressing and infuriating to look at your build and powers menus and see lots of little padlocks.
This isn't how RTS works - that choice and spread of units is key. It's just a grindy, exaggerated throwback to the bad old days of single-player RTS campaigns, when all sense of momentum and progress was artificially hung around denying you the better units until the later levels. It's like a long, unskippable tutorial.
(...)
The upside is that you'll definitely learn the units rather than make a dash for the big stuff every time. You'll really come to value the tier-1 infantry and especially the bouncy, healy/grabby/fighty Engineers. The downside is: give me the game I have paid for! These aren't just a few fun bonuses. They're the entire bloody tech tree.
It's even harder to accept because it also seems like a feeble attempt to justify the always-online requirement. Yep, just like Ubisoft's contempt-to-the-max DRM system, this will kick you out if your net connection drops for any reason - even in single-player.
(...)
On the one hand, it's important to look at this as its own game rather than through change-fearing spectacles. On the other, it's called Command & Conquer 4, and that bald bloke who keeps waving his arms and talking about ascension is all over it. It's still aimed at the fans. That it is such a giant step away from the mechanics C&C has clung onto for so long is bold and exciting in concept, but so absolute in practice that it's an insult to the faithful. |  |  |  |  |
